Simply so, is it OK to pick up a snapping turtle by the tail?
Snapping turtles have powerful jaws and long necks. Do not place your hands near the front half of the turtle. Do not pick the turtle up by the tail, as you can injure the bones of the tail and back. If you have an appropriately sized box or container, try to gently push the turtle into the box from behind.

Just so, how do you attract snapping turtles?
Catch the Turtles with a Floating Jug Tie one end of a strong fishing line to a tightly-sealed milk jug. Tie the other end to a fishing hook. Attach a tasty bait to the hook then place the trap in the pond. The snapping turtle will get hooked and won't be able to submerge due to the floating jug.
Do pet turtles like to be held?
Turtles prefer to be alone, and they never welcome being picked up and handled. Because turtles aren't affectionate, don't like to be held, stroked or cuddled and don't play with toys, many people lose interest and cease to take proper care of them.

Snapping turtles are omnivores and will eat a whole bunch of stuff. In the wild, they'll eat water plants, fish, frogs, pollywogs, newts, bugs, snails, worms, and snakes.
